Consider these three inequalities.

l. x/4<0
ll. 9x<-9
lll. 14≤3x+14

For which of these inequalities is x=0 a solution?

I only

III only

I and II

I and III

Let's evaluate each inequality to see if \( x = 0 \) is a solution.

1. For the first inequality \( \frac{x}{4} < 0 \):
- When \( x = 0 \), we have \( \frac{0}{4} < 0 \), which simplifies to \( 0 < 0 \). This is **false**. So, \( x = 0 \) is **not** a solution.

2. For the second inequality \( 9x < -9 \):
- When \( x = 0 \), we have \( 9(0) < -9 \), which simplifies to \( 0 < -9 \). This is **false**. So, \( x = 0 \) is **not** a solution.

3. For the third inequality \( 14 \leq 3x + 14 \):
- When \( x = 0 \), we have \( 14 \leq 3(0) + 14 \), which simplifies to \( 14 \leq 14 \). This is **true**. So, \( x = 0 \) is a solution.

Now let's summarize:
- \( x = 0 \) is a solution for **III only**.

Thus, the answer is **III only**.
